The MASMCG11CAE3 belongs to the category of semiconductor devices.
It is used as a protection diode in electronic circuits to prevent damage from voltage spikes and transient overvoltage conditions.
The MASMCG11CAE3 is typically available in a surface mount package.
The essence of MASMCG11CAE3 lies in its ability to protect sensitive electronic components from voltage transients.

When a voltage transient occurs, the MASMCG11CAE3 conducts and clamps the voltage to a safe level, protecting the downstream circuitry.
The MASMCG11CAE3 is commonly used in the following applications: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ems
